SITUATION:
The property is situated on a no-through road towards the Northen edge of the village.
Paradoxically, the village name 'Combe' denotes a valley although the village itself is located on high ground at the edge of the Blenheim estate. The village is centred around a traditional green that is the venue for annual fireworks displays, Maypole dance and an autumn travelling fair - all within a stone's throw of The Cock Inn. The village's only public house dates from the end of the 17th century. The local Church of England primary school was rated as 'good' by Ofsted in Julu 2022. In addition to a 12th century parish church, there is also a Methodist chapel. Combe Halt just outside the village is provides a limited rail service. More frequent services are available at Hanborough (2.7 miles) with journey times to Oxford and London Paddington of 9 and 68 minutes respectively. The recently opened Oxford Parkway (9.9 miles) connects to London Marylebone with a journey time of 56 minutes.
The nearby village of Long Hanborough offers a supermarket, dentist, medical centre and a very good fish and chip shop!

Broadband speed is measured in megabits per second, with the number returned showing how fast the connection is. Each reading is based on the highest predicted speed of any major broadband network for services that deliver the download speeds. The following are the different readings that we may display:
Basic: Up to 30 Mbit/s
Super-fast: Between 30 Mbit/s and 300 Mbit/s
Ultra-fast: Over 300 Mbit/s
The data is updated three times a year. The checker results are predictions and should not be regarded as guaranteed. For more information, see: https://checker.ofcom.org.uk/en-gb/about-checker#Answer_0_2

Mobile signal predictions are provided by the four UK mobile network operators: EE, O2, Three and Vodafone. Predictions can vary significantly from the coverage you may actually experience as a result of local factors (especially terrain). Ofcom has tested the actual coverage provided in various locations around the UK to help ensure that these predictions are reasonable. The values shown against a property can be broken down as follows:
Clear: No bars, no signal predicted
Red: One bar, reliable signal unlikely
Amber: Two bars, may experience problems with connectivity
Green: Three bars, likely to have good coverage and receive a data rate to support basic web services
Enhanced: Full bars, likely to have good coverage indoors and to receive an enhanced data rate to support multimedia services
